Latest Patents

Akram Ahmadi holds a patent for a "Broadside detection system and techniques for use in a vehicular radar." This invention presents a method and apparatus for detecting static objects and broadside vehicles within a vehicular radar system. The system acquires detection data within the field of view for a host vehicle. A histogram process is employed to determine the presence of at least one of a static object and a broadside vehicle. The process involves generating ratios of the relative velocity of an object to the host vehicle's velocity and determining the number of detections occurring at specific angles. The detections are filtered to identify points indicating the presence of static objects and/or broadside vehicles.

Career Highlights

Akram Ahmadi is currently associated with Valeo Radar Systems, Inc., where he applies his expertise in radar technology. His work has contributed to advancements in vehicular safety and detection systems.
